The Great (dead) Count

Ok, so you've heard what a long boring drive it was across the nullarbor....for three long days. We needed a plan - we had a plan! (well, while Adam was moaning, Alexia had a plan!) 'I know,' Lex said, 'what better way to pass the hours by than to count all the dead things we see along the way?!' 'Terrific' said Ad....and so the great Nullarbor Tally began....

Now the results are in... enjoy!

Hours Driven: approx 15 hours
Distance travelled: 1224kms

Road Trains: 139
Campers/Caravans: 61
Cars/utes/etc: 205
Cyclists (Health freak nutters): 3
Motorcyclists: 1



Dead Roos: 185
Live Roos (nearly killed by Adam may I add!): 1
Dead Camels: 2
Dead Birds: 10
Dead Emu's: 1
Dead Snakes: 14
Live Snakes: 2
Dead Lizards: 43
Live Lizards: 24
Dead Wombats: 6
Dead Rodents: 27
USOs (Unidentified Squashed Object): 21

Time Zones: 2
RFDS (Royal Flying Docs) Airstrips: 5
Jesus Signs ('Where will you spend eternity?' - hopefully not on this sodding long road!): 2
